If your New Year’s resolutions were to lose weight and save money, there’s a Filipino restaurant in Brooklyn, New York that really wants you to break both of them simultaneously.
The Manila Social Club just introduced a new item . . . a $100 DONUT! What does that work out to be? About $20 a bite?
Here’s how they justify the price. The donut is filled with a mix of mousse and champagne jelly . . . the icing is made out of Cristal champagne . . . and the top is covered in 24-karat gold flakes. CLICK HERE to see a photo and get the full scoop!
The owner of Manila Social Club says they’re actually selling . . . and people aren’t just buying one.
Quote, “I didn’t know people would go and order a dozen at a time. But then again, it is New York, and there are people willing to put down a grand for a dozen donuts.”
